BROOKINGS, S.D. -- A small Bruin distance track squad concluded their season at Sunday's NSAA Indoor Track and Field Championships held at the Sanford-Jackrabbit Athletic Complex on the South Dakota State University campus. A total of five Bruins took part in two events, the mile run and the 3,000-meter run.

Olivia Russo ran to a tenth-place finish in the mile run, clocking a time of 6:11.40. The remaining Bruin athletes contested the 3,000-meter run, with three of four runners posting a season-best, highlighted by Collin Kotz running the fourth-best time in Bruin history. Kotz missed an All-Conference award (top 3) by just 0.03 seconds, running 9:14.07, a six-second improvement on his previous outing. Griffin Kipchumba reduced his season best by eight seconds, recording a 9:42.30. For the Bruin women, Alicia Rivera Camargo put her name on the Bruin top ten list with a 11:56.02, a huge 35-second improvement. Ashley Guatemala was the final Bruin competitor, running 12:59.99.

Head Coach Craig Christians: "We finished on a high note on what has been a tough indoor season filled with injuries and illness. We'll take about a month to do some training and be ready to go outdoors at the end of March."

The Bruins open their outdoor season on March 23 at the Viking Relays hosted by Grandview University in Des Moines.
